The Key to Motivating Your Dog

If you find your dogs response to commands, especially around distractions, is lack luster at best, than take a look at what you’re using for motivation. The type of rewards you use in training can make the difference between a dog who learns slowly and has little desire to do what you ask and a dog who responds quickly and enthusiastically every single time.
